探索智能链接预览:Link Preview 模块
项目简介
Link Preview 是一个高效的 AngularJS 和 PHP 实现的组件,能够在输入框中实时识别并展示网页链接预览。通过智能解析 URL 的源代码,提取关键信息如标题、图片和简短描述,它能帮助你在社交媒体或任何需要输入链接的地方提供更直观的信息展示。
技术剖析
该项目的核心在于它的算法,该算法监听用户在输入框中的文本变化,并通过正则表达式检测 URL。一旦 URL 被识别,PHP 端开始工作,对 URL 进行深入分析。它寻找页面标题、图像和内容摘要,为用户提供一个完整的预览体验。支持多种布局模式,包括右、左、上、下以及视频和图库预览。
应用场景
- 社交媒体平台:提升用户体验,让用户无需点击链接就能了解网页内容。
- 在线论坛:确保用户共享的内容清晰可见,提高参与度。
- 内部协作工具:快速分享链接,让团队成员一目了然链接的内容。
- 个人博客或网站评论系统:让评论中的链接更具互动性。
项目特点
- 实时预览:无论何时添加新 URL,都会立即呈现预览,无需刷新页面。
- 多布局支持:可以自定义预览位置(右、左、上、下)以适应不同的设计需求。
- 高度可配置:允许调整预览数量、加载提示文本、按钮样式等,满足个性化要求。
- 数据库集成:可将预览信息存储到数据库,方便数据管理和检索。
- 响应式设计:适配各种屏幕尺寸,确保在移动设备上也表现良好。
- 兼容性广:基于广泛支持的 PHP 和 AngularJS,能在多数环境中正常运行。
要将 Link Preview 添加到你的项目中,只需几步简单的步骤:
- 引入必要的 CSS 和 JS 文件。
- 配置 AngularJS 模块和指令。
- 自定义属性以匹配你的界面需求。
- (可选)与数据库集成,保存和检索链接预览。
总的来说,Link Preview 是一款强大且易于集成的工具,能够显著增强你的应用程序的交互性和可用性。现在就将其纳入你的开发工具箱,提升用户的链接预览体验吧!